mail.com Internet Explorer Addon
What is mail.com Internet Explorer Addon?
mail.com Internet Explorer Addon is software application developed by 1&1 Mail & Media Inc.. It is most commonly found on computers running Windows 7 with nearly 82.50% of installations running this operating system. mail.com Internet Explorer Addon's installer is typically 498.00 KB in size and installs around 3 files.
mail.com Internet Explorer Addon is most popular in the United States with 72.88% of installations residing in this country.
mail.com Internet Explorer Addon adds 1 scheduled task to the Windows Task Scheduler launching the program at randomly scheduled times.
About mail.com Internet Explorer Addon?
This software is a BHO (Browser Helper Object) that seamlessly integrates with Internet Explorer, allowing users to conveniently access and view their mail.com emails directly within the browser. During installation, users will have the option to set their default search engine to mail.com.
